#f72833 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f72833 is composed of 96.9% red, 15.7%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.8% magenta, 79.4%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 356.8 degrees, a saturation of 92.8% and a lightness of 56.3%. #f72833 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5066 with #ef0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#f72833 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f72833 has RGB values of R:247, G:40,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.84, Y:0.79,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16197683.

Shades and Tints of #f72833
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0001 is the darkest color, while #fff8f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f72833
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908f8f is the less saturated color, while #f72833 is the most saturated one.
